The Trade Breakdown: A Seven-Team Blockbuster

The July 2025 trade saw Phoenix deal Durant, a two-time NBA champion, to Houston for a package headlined by Jalen Green (22.3 PPG, 23 years old), Dillon Brooks (12.7 PPG), and prospects Khaman Maluach, Rasheer Fleming, and Koby Brea, plus 2026 and 2032 second-round picks, per ESPN. Plowden was waived post-trade, per Sofascore. This move, the NBA’s most complex offseason transaction, involved seven teams and redistributed $150 million in salaries, per Spotrac. Durant’s Contract Outlook: A High-Value Extension

Entering the final year of his $194 million deal, Durant, 37, faces a pivotal contract negotiation before hitting unrestricted free agency in July 2026, per Spotrac. Despite playing only 55 and 58 games in the last two seasons due to a 2019 Achilles injury, his All-NBA production—27.9 PPG, 1.2 BPG—commands a lucrative extension, per The Athletic. Keith Smith of Spotrac notes Durant isn’t chasing a max deal ($60M annually), easing Houston’s $162.3 million payroll, just $15.8 million below the first apron, per Spotrac. Smith predicts a two-year, $90–100 million extension with a player option, balancing Durant’s elite scoring (4th in NBA scoring since 2020) and Houston’s rising costs with extensions for Green ($35M projected) and Alperen Şengün ($40M), per CBS Sports. The Rockets’ patient approach avoids rushed decisions, per Bleacher Report.
